CalTrout Receives Wildlife Conservation Board Grant to Advance Habitat Restoration on the Shasta River
Big Spring Ranch Habitat Implementation Grant will fund shovel-ready instream habitat projects at Big Springs Ranch, one of the Shasta River's highest-priority spring-fed reaches.
